Couchbase 1.8.0并发性(java客户端/服务器中的并发请求支持数量):可伸缩性 服务器上每秒提供的请求数或同时提供的请求数是否有任何限制。[在配置中,不是由于RAM、CPU等硬件限制] JavaServlet中CouchbaseClient实例上同时请求的数量是否有任何限制 最好是在CouchbaseClient上只创建一个实例并保持其打开状态,还是创建多个实例并销毁 Moxi对Couchbase 1.8.0服务器/Couchbase java客户端1.0.2有帮助吗

Couchbase 1.8.0并发性(java客户端/服务器中的并发请求支持数量):可伸缩性 服务器上每秒提供的请求数或同时提供的请求数是否有任何限制。[在配置中,不是由于RAM、CPU等硬件限制] JavaServlet中CouchbaseClient实例上同时请求的数量是否有任何限制 最好是在CouchbaseClient上只创建一个实例并保持其打开状态,还是创建多个实例并销毁 Moxi对Couchbase 1.8.0服务器/Couchbase java客户端1.0.2有帮助吗,couchbase,membase,Couchbase,Membase,我需要这些信息来设置生产中的应用程序 谢谢 Couchbase后面运行的memcached实例有一个 连接限制为10000个连接。普通沙发 建议您增加要寻址的节点数 该层的交通分布 客户机本身没有硬编码的限制 它与Couchbase群集的许多连接 Couchbase通常建议您创建一个连接池 从您的应用程序到集群,只需重新使用它们 连接与创造,并一次又一次地破坏它们。在…上 较重的负载应用,产生和破坏这些 一次又一次的连接可能会让资源变得非常昂贵 透视图 莫西是一个完整的沙发底座。然而,它通常是

我需要这些信息来设置生产中的应用程序

谢谢

  • Couchbase后面运行的memcached实例有一个 连接限制为10000个连接。普通沙发 建议您增加要寻址的节点数 该层的交通分布
  • 客户机本身没有硬编码的限制 它与Couchbase群集的许多连接
  • Couchbase通常建议您创建一个连接池 从您的应用程序到集群,只需重新使用它们 连接与创造,并一次又一次地破坏它们。在…上 较重的负载应用,产生和破坏这些 一次又一次的连接可能会让资源变得非常昂贵 透视图
  • 莫西是一个完整的沙发底座。然而,它通常是 作为适配器层提供给客户机开发人员 使用它或为设计为直接访问的应用程序提供遗留访问权限 访问memcached接口。如果您使用的是Couchbase客户端 驱动程序您不需要使用Moxi接口

  • 请注意,10k连接不是一个“硬”限制,但它不是一个常见的覆盖。另外请注意,增加节点的数量并不一定会有帮助,因为每个客户端都连接到每个服务器。非常感谢您的回答。我主要关心的是扩展应用程序。我正在使用Couchbase java客户端和Jetty服务器。只有一个couchbase客户端实例就足够了,或者我需要创建一个客户端池。在后一种情况下,是否有库可以这样做?@hridayesh-您应该为每个应用程序创建一个连接池,尽管一般来说5个左右的连接对于一般应用程序来说已经足够了。@mattingenshron-硬限制是在Couchbase中的memcached中。改变它的唯一方法是构建一个couchbase运行的包装器,修改erlang正在运行的命令,然后使用新的连接限制运行实际的memcached程序。此外,每个客户机并不拥有到集群中每个节点的连接。它调用第一台服务器,得到vbucket映射,然后使用该映射连接到一个节点,该节点基于Couchbase的内部负载平衡系统。@Drahkar连接绝对是持久的。它不是“节点之一”,而是特定密钥的目的地。我知道我在说什么,我现在是Couchbase Java客户端和Spymecached客户端的主要开发人员。我设计了服务器和客户端之间的REST接口。我知道它是如何工作的我不建议在大多数情况下将客户端对象池化。